Fair Tax Treatment for Insurance Agents' Termination Payments Act of 2001 - Amends the Internal Revenue Code to consider a qualified termination payment received from an insurance company by a former insurance salesman for such company as a sale or exchange of a capital asset held for more than 12 months.…
